National Building Museum (EIN: 52-1050999) has filed an IRS Form 990 since at least fiscal year 2016. In its fiscal year 2021 IRS Form 990 filing, National Building Museum, a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 3 out of 85 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$126,360. The highest compensated employee at National Building Museum is Chase W Rynd with fiscal year 2021 compensation of $137,108.
